-----Interview with Wang **, Aramark intern at the Athletes Village
p>With the Olympic Games in full swing, our volunteers and interns are also starting to get busy. “Although I am very busy, I feel very happy.” Wang **, an Aramark intern at the Athletes Village, said with a smile.
Wang **’s working hours are from 2 pm to 11 pm. Since he has missed the last bus at 11pm and it is difficult to wait for the Olympic bus, Wang ** rides a bicycle to and from work every day. "There is a parking lot for bicycles there, which is more convenient."
When asked about his job, Wang ** excitedly introduced his job to us. "I am a RUNNER, but I am different from the food runner because I am responsible for cold drinks, including fruits, milk, various teas and coffees, etc. My main task is to take out items from the frozen warehouse at any time and place them on the counter. Make sure the items on the counter are always full."
When asked if he was tired from work, Wang ** smiled and said, "Of course I am, I am responsible for the cold drinks on the six counters. , I have to pay attention to replenishing supplies every day, so I have to be quick and responsive. In addition, I have to stand guard for about two hours every day, mainly standing at the door and saying 'hello' to the athletes coming in and out. '. Provide help to them when necessary. I also got an Olympic badge when I was standing guard. It was given by a national athlete." Then he proudly showed us the beautiful badge pinned to the yellow belt of his volunteer ID card. . "Actually, I still hope to be more tired at work. Being busy makes me feel happy. If I am idle, I will feel a bit bored."
Like other interns, Wang ** believes that he has learned a lot from work. Lots and lots. "At first, my job was mainly to assemble the machine. I assemble the components one by one according to the instructions. I had never done this kind of work before, so I was a little confused; but then I gradually learned it." "Also, I learned from my supervisor. Learned. The supervisor is very humorous, but he is very conscientious in his work. Every day we have a summary meeting to summarize the gains and losses of the day in order to make our service better."
Finally. , he also added: "Although I am very busy and tired, I learned a lot from it. This will be very beneficial to me in the future. I think the experience of being an intern this summer is very meaningful. So I am also very happy."
I hope all volunteers and interns can be as busy and happy as Wang**. With our enthusiasm and smiles, we will contribute our share to the Beijing 2008 Olympic Games. Look, the sacred fire above the Bird's Nest is shining with our passion and blood for the Olympics.

Safe Olympics is in my heart
-----Interview with Mr. Zhang **, a traffic station driver volunteer
When I first met Teacher Zhang, it was hard to believe that he had already been driving for 13 years. Teacher Zhang looks very young and talkative. He always maintains an amiable smile, making the interview atmosphere very relaxed and harmonious.
Teacher Zhang is a driver volunteer in the T1 team of the transportation station, specializing in receiving officials from the Olympic Organizing Committee or heads of officials from various countries. Teacher Zhang feels very honored and proud of this more than one month of volunteer service experience.
The indissoluble bond with the Olympics
Talking about the indissoluble bond with the Olympics, Teacher Zhang smiled happily. "Because a teacher in the same department was very passionate about the Olympics, he wanted to become an Olympic volunteer, and he put in a lot of effort. But in the end, he failed because some conditions were not met. So he wanted me to try, Let’s fulfill this dream for him. At first, I thought it was an honor to be an Olympic volunteer and contribute my part to the Beijing Olympics, so I went for the interview.”
I have been training for the Olympics for two years.
It takes about two years from registration to the end of the training. In the past two years, Teacher Zhang has been engaged in teaching work while actively participating in various trainings and activities organized by the Olympic Organizing Committee and the Municipal Youth League Committee. I have put in a lot of effort and gone through a lot in order not to make any mistakes in just ten days of service. Teacher Zhang said: "Although I have much less rest time, I still persevered for the Olympics. My family and colleagues are very supportive of me, which is one of the motivations for me to persevere." During these two years, Teacher Zhang In addition to the necessary foreign language training and driving skills training, he also learned some Olympic-related knowledge, gaining a deeper understanding and understanding of the Olympics, which also enabled him to better show the style of the Beijing Olympics in his words and deeds.
Always keep in mind a safe Olympics
For the Olympics, Teacher Zhang’s deepest feeling is that “a safe Olympics is the most important thing.” Teacher Zhang is a very meticulous person. Every day, he regularly checks the parts and other parts of the car to ensure that the car can run safely. Although Mr. Zhang is very confident in his driving skills, he is still very careful and conscientious every time he drives. Teacher Zhang said: "A safe Olympics requires the efforts of each of us. Any neglect of details may cause unsafe risks, so we need to keep a safe Olympics in mind at all times and do every detail well." With Safe Olympics in mind, Teacher Zhang did not make any mistakes during more than a month of volunteer service at the Olympics.
Unity, dedication, I am happy
During the service, Teacher Zhang always got off work at 12 o'clock in the evening. "Because I work with a lesbian, she takes the daytime class and I take the evening class." Teacher Zhang said with a smile, "Other volunteers alternate between the two classes. Although it is a little tiring, But I'm still very happy. "Sometimes, Teacher Zhang has to work very late before going home. "Because those presidents had to go out at night for business, they had to be busy late at night. One time I didn't come back until four in the morning."
Teacher Zhang is also a sports fan. In previous Olympic Games, Mr. Zhang would either buy tickets and watch them live, or watch the games on the TV. However, at this year's Beijing Olympics, he was unable to watch the games as usual due to volunteer service. Although a little regretful, Teacher Zhang is very satisfied, "Volunteer service certainly requires dedication, and dedication is also a kind of happiness. When the president goes to watch the game, I can also accompany him to watch. This way, I am already very satisfied. "
Olympic Service and Teaching Service
When talking about the impact that more than a month of Olympic volunteer service will have on future life and teaching work, Teacher Zhang said: "Olympic Service Volunteer service is a kind of service, and teaching is also a kind of service. I learned a lot from more than a month of volunteer service, which will also help me in my future teaching work and enable me to better serve students in the future. ”
Confidently give yourself 90 points
Finally, when asked Teacher Zhang how many points he would give to his volunteer service, Teacher Zhang confidently gave himself 90 points.
"I have done my part for the Olympics, so I am very satisfied with my work for more than a month." After finishing speaking, Teacher Zhang smiled with satisfaction.
From Teacher Zhang, I saw the glory of being an Olympic volunteer. They always smile, serve enthusiastically, and contribute selflessly. Although there have been hardships and tears, they still used their brightest smiles to witness the best business card of the Beijing 2008 Olympic Games.
